Ottawa Blocks Privacy Watchdog From Testifying on Secret Surveillance Bill
The federal Liberals have blocked a Conservative push to bring Canada's Privacy Commissioner back to a House of Commons committee. The opposition wanted the watchdog to weigh in on proposed changes to the government's controversial lawful access legislation, known as Bill C-22.
